pub struct DocConfig { /* private fields */ }Expand description
Documentation configuration
Implementations§
Source§impl DocConfig
impl DocConfig
Sourcepub fn set_format(&mut self, format: DocFormat)
pub fn set_format(&mut self, format: DocFormat)
Set documentation format
Sourcepub fn set_include_examples(&mut self, include: bool)
pub fn set_include_examples(&mut self, include: bool)
Enable/disable examples
Sourcepub fn set_include_source_links(&mut self, include: bool)
pub fn set_include_source_links(&mut self, include: bool)
Enable/disable source links
Sourcepub fn set_include_private(&mut self, include: bool)
pub fn set_include_private(&mut self, include: bool)
Enable/disable private member documentation
Sourcepub fn set_generate_playground(&mut self, generate: bool)
pub fn set_generate_playground(&mut self, generate: bool)
Enable/disable playground generation
Sourcepub fn set_output_directory(&mut self, dir: String)
pub fn set_output_directory(&mut self, dir: String)
Set output directory
Sourcepub fn set_base_url(&mut self, url: String)
pub fn set_base_url(&mut self, url: String)
Set base URL
Sourcepub fn set_version(&mut self, version: String)
pub fn set_version(&mut self, version: String)
Set version
Trait Implementations§
Source§impl FromWasmAbi for DocConfig
impl FromWasmAbi for DocConfig
Source§impl IntoWasmAbi for DocConfig
impl IntoWasmAbi for DocConfig
Source§impl LongRefFromWasmAbi for DocConfig
impl LongRefFromWasmAbi for DocConfig
Source§impl OptionFromWasmAbi for DocConfig
impl OptionFromWasmAbi for DocConfig
Source§impl OptionIntoWasmAbi for DocConfig
impl OptionIntoWasmAbi for DocConfig
Source§impl RefFromWasmAbi for DocConfig
impl RefFromWasmAbi for DocConfig
Source§impl RefMutFromWasmAbi for DocConfig
impl RefMutFromWasmAbi for DocConfig
Source§impl TryFromJsValue for DocConfig
impl TryFromJsValue for DocConfig
Source§impl VectorFromWasmAbi for DocConfig
impl VectorFromWasmAbi for DocConfig
Source§impl VectorIntoWasmAbi for DocConfig
impl VectorIntoWasmAbi for DocConfig
impl SupportsConstructor for DocConfig
impl SupportsInstanceProperty for DocConfig
impl SupportsStaticProperty for DocConfig
Auto Trait Implementations§
impl Freeze for DocConfig
impl RefUnwindSafe for DocConfig
impl Send for DocConfig
impl Sync for DocConfig
impl Unpin for DocConfig
impl UnsafeUnpin for DocConfig
impl UnwindSafe for DocConfig
Blanket Implementations§
Source§impl<T> BorrowMut<T> for Twhere
T: ?Sized,
impl<T> BorrowMut<T> for Twhere
T: ?Sized,
Source§fn borrow_mut(&mut self) -> &mut T
fn borrow_mut(&mut self) -> &mut T
Mutably borrows from an owned value. Read more
Source§impl<T> CloneToUninit for Twhere
T: Clone,
impl<T> CloneToUninit for Twhere
T: Clone,
Source§impl<T> ReturnWasmAbi for Twhere
T: IntoWasmAbi,
impl<T> ReturnWasmAbi for Twhere
T: IntoWasmAbi,
Source§type Abi = <T as IntoWasmAbi>::Abi
type Abi = <T as IntoWasmAbi>::Abi
Same as
IntoWasmAbi::AbiSource§fn return_abi(self) -> <T as ReturnWasmAbi>::Abi
fn return_abi(self) -> <T as ReturnWasmAbi>::Abi
Same as
IntoWasmAbi::into_abi, except that it may throw and never
return in the case of Err.